In The Wealth of Nations, Adam Smith argued that
A. the free market should regulate business activity.
B. freely elected governments should make economic decisions.
C. government power should be divided into three branches.
D. the state should regulate foreign trade to insure national wealth.

Respuesta :

The answer is A.  The Wealth of Nations advocated Laissez-faire economic theory (free market without government interference), saying that individuals should freely pursue their own economic interests.
